Research Seminar Series 2019/2020
Coordinator: Hannah Durand and Kiran Sarma
Seminars take place monthly during semester in the School of Psychology, 1-2 pm.
A light lunch is served in the ground floor foyer of the School of Psychology from 12.30 in advance of the seminars. All are welcome.
All seminars take place in room AMB-G065 in the Arts Millennium Building unless otherwise indicated below.
Semester 1 2019/2020
Date | Venue | Speaker | Title |
---|---|---|---|
18 Sep 2019 | G066 | Dr Gerry Molloy, Lecturer, School of Psychology, NUI Galway | Treatment Adherence Across the Lifespan: 5 Grand Challenges/Opportunities? |
2 Oct 2019 | G065 | Dr Craig Macneil, Senior Clinical Psychologist, ORYGEN Youth Health, University of Melbourne | Cognitive Behavioural Therapy for Bipolar Disorder: The Opportunity for Early Intervention |
13 Nov 2019 | G066 | Dr Simon Bacon, Professor, Department of Health, Kinesiology & Applied Physiology, Concordia University | Behavioural Interventions to Enhance Asthma Management |
11 Dec 2019 | G065 | Dr Pádraig Ó Féich, Research Officer, Mental Health Reform | My Voice Matters: Findings from a National Consulation with Mental Health Service Users and Relatives and Carers/Supporters |
Semester 2 2019/20
Date | Venue | Speaker | Title |
---|---|---|---|
19 Feb 2020 | G065 | Dr Ioana Latu, Lecturer, School of Psychology, Queen's University Belfast | The Psychology of Gender: Implications for Athena SWAN initiatives |
11 Mar 2020 | G065 | Professor Gary Donohoe, Established Professor, School of Psychology, NUI Galway / Dr Mary Rose Mulry, Postdoctoral Researcher, Centre for Pain Research, NUI Galway | Young People with Serios Mental Health Problems: Building Evidence to Meet Needs / Dementia and Meaningful Occupation |
1 Apr 2020 | G065 | Dr Berglind Sveinbiornsdóttir, Lecturer, School of Social Sciences, Reykjavik University | Challenging Behaviour and Preference in Transitions Between Relatively Rich and Lean Reinforcement Context |
